Day 3
Arcachon and Europe the highest Dune
A trip to the picturesque resort town of Arcachon on the Atlantic coast. Walk through the famous “Winter City” district, where elegant 19th-century villas with unique architecture have been preserved.
Afterward, we’ll head to the region’s natural wonder—the Dune of Pyla, the biggest sand dune in Europe. We’ll climb to the top, where breathtaking panoramic views of the Atlantic, pine forests, and golden sandy expanses await.
Day 4
The Cap Ferret Lighthouse and a Taste of the Atlantic
A trip to the picturesque Cap Ferret Peninsula. We’ll climb the lighthouse, which offers a stunning view of the ocean, Arcachon Bay, and the famous Dune du Pilat.
A walk along the ocean to experience the atmosphere of the authentic French Atlantic.
Then we’ll visit oyster farms, where you can taste the freshest oysters and seafood with a glass of chilled white wine. This is a true Atlantic culinary ritual and one of the most distinctive flavors of France.
